Evacuation Plan is the fourth episode of Red vs. Blue: Season 9 and the 177th episode overall.

Plot[]

After witnessing Church getting shot, Tucker and Caboose question if they should help him. Caboose concludes that he can't get a good shot of Church from a top the cliff. On ground level, Church tells the Reds that their personalties are all wrong, except for Simmons, who is doesn't seem to have changed at all. Donut decides that he has heard enough and points his gun at Church. In response, Church tells Donut to start keeping a journal or a diary to express himself before limping back to Blue Base. The Reds then begin to discuss Church's nerve. Donut accidentally reveals that he has a diary and leaves to go write about his experience, much to Grif's dismay as Donut tracks mud through the base. Sarge and Simmons continue to talk about Church, saying that while he was talking nonesense, he was so sure of himself.

The scene cuts to the destruction of the Bjørndal Cryogenics Research Facility, with a Pelican, carrying North, South, and Carolina, flying away. Carolina, who is co-piloting alongside pilot Four Seven Niner, answers an incoming transmission from F.I.L.S.S. They begin a conversation about how the Director was right to send Carolina along on the mission, despite North and South's reaction. South straps North into a seat of the Pelican and spots two Longswords following them, who begin their pursuit on the Freelancers and a chase ensues. As the Longswords attack, Four Seven Niner maneuvers the Pelican behind the fighters, avoiding the missiles by deploying flares while performing a barrel roll. South is then soon knocked out at the back of the Pelican, waking up North.

As Four Seven clears North for equipment usage, North straps South into a seat. Due to the damage he received, his helmet malfunctions, so he removes it. North climbs out onto the Pelican's roof and deploys his Domed Energy Shield to protect the Pelican from missiles deployed by the Longswords. The Pelican reaches the rendezvous point, increasing its speed in order to make it, causing North to fall back into the Pelican. At the rendezvous, an energy blast takes out one of the Longswords as the shooter, a Frigate called "Mother of Invention", emerges from behind a group of clouds. The other Longsword tries to retreat, but it is destroyed as well. The Pelican begins to land and F.I.L.S.S. states that medical personel will be waiting in the landing bay for North.
